1. State Dept. Receives Application to Expand Port of Entry at Nogales, AZ
The State Department has issued a public notice announcing that it has received an application for a permit authorizing the construction, operation, and maintenance of two additional commercial cargo lanes at the Mariposa Port of Entry at Nogales, AZ. According to the State Department, this expansion would reconfigure the Mariposa Port and allow for the construction of two Free and Secure Trade (FAST) lanes. 7. DEA Correction to Final Rule on Exemption of Certain Chemical Mixtures
The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) has issued a technical correction to its December 15, 2004 final rule to exempt from certain recordkeeping and reporting requirements both domestic and import transactions in mixtures containing the List II chemicals acetone, ethyl ether, 2-butanone, and toluene. 8. Foreign-Trade Zones Board Actions
The Foreign-Trade Zones Board (FTZB) has issued the following notices of recent FTZB actions:
FTZ applicant/grantee | Company or action |
Pinellas County Board of County Commissioners (FTZ 193A) | Approval of application to expand manufacturing authority within Subzone 193A on behalf of Cardinal Health 409, Inc. |
Louisville and Jefferson County Riverport Authority (FTZ 29) | Approval of application to expand FTZ 29-Site 4 to include an additional parcel at the Louisville Metro Commerce Center |
Vicksburg-Jackson Foreign Trade Zone, Inc. (FTZ 158) | Approval of request on behalf of Nissan North America, Inc. (NNA) for expanded manufacturing authority |
Foreign Trade Zone of Central Texas, Inc. (FTZ 183) | Approval of application to reorganize and expand FTZ 183 and reduce zone space at Subzone 183A (Dell Computer Corporation) |
Brattleboro Foreign Trade Zone LLC | Submission of application to establish general-purpose FTZ at sites in Brattleboro, VT |
